Good afternoon. Have recently purchased Lumia 820 phone as upgrade from my old great Nokia E71. Encountered a problem to carry all my Landmarks from E71 "collected" during 5 years of usage to Lumia 820. When sending Landmark from E71 to Lumia 820 by Bluetooth somewhy Lumia 820 can not recognize / read received file / landmark. Are there any kind of applets or other way how I can proceed using my old E71 landmarks at Lumia 820 ?
Also, can somebody guide me how I can create new Landmarks in Nokia Maps in Lumia 820 ? Have investigated this issue though and out but were unable to find any solution so far. Please help!

Unfortunately there is no way to import "Landmarks" in form of .lmx, however any "Favourites" synchronised from Ovi Maps application via your Nokia account can be accessed provided Nokia Maps "Online" upon your 820.
